Sunrex Technology Corp - Asset Resilience Ratio
Sunrex Technology Corp (2387) has an Asset Resilience Ratio of 10.38% as of March 2026. The Asset Resilience Ratio measures the percentage of a company's total assets that are held in liquid form (cash and short-term investments). This metric indicates how well-positioned the company is to handle unexpected financial challenges, economic downturns, or strategic opportunities without requiring external financing. About Sunrex Technology Corp
Sunrex Technology Corporation engages in the manufacture and sale of laptop computer keyboards worldwide. It offers wired/wireless keyboard and mouse, HTPC multimedia keyboards, leather casing keyboards for tablet computers, touch-controlled keyboards, gaming keyboards, and mice, as well as 3D air keyboards and mice.
